
Diglipur, July 12: As part of the District Administration, North & Middle Andaman’s public outreach initiative, ‘Sampark Se Samadhan – Prashasan Gaon Ki Ore’, Shri Sushant Padha, IAS, Deputy Commissioner, North & Middle Andaman, conducted an extensive village outreach programme and Jan Sunwai in the villages of Subashgram, Sitanagar, Kishorinagar and Paschimsagar under Diglipur Tehsil. Accompanied by PRI representatives and Heads of Departments, the Deputy Commissioner undertook field inspections, interacted with residents through door-to-door visits, reviewed the progress of developmental works, visited the households affected by recent flooding caused by heavy rainfall, inspected schools and Anganwadi Centres, assessed the delivery of essential public services and heard public grievances for their prompt redressal.
The Deputy Commissioner directed all concerned Departments to ensure prompt redressal of public grievances and effective follow-up action on issues raised by residents. He emphasized that developmental works should be completed within the stipulated timelines while maintaining quality standards and ensuring that Government welfare schemes reach every eligible beneficiary.
Reiterating the Administration’s commitment to people-centric governance, the Deputy Commissioner stated that “Sampark Se Samadhan – Prashasan Gaon Ki Ore” continues to strengthen public service delivery by taking governance to the doorstep of the people, facilitating timely redressal of grievances, closely monitoring developmental works and ensuring that the benefits of Government programmes reach even the remotest villages of North & Middle Andaman District.
